Show Originjof Forest Fires Information Given Out By Local Forest For-est Office Contains interesting Figures Somo very Interesting Information regarding forest fires h3 just been prepared by tho United. States forestry fores-try department and through tho courtesy of Supervisor Clinton l. Smith, tho information Is he e given: Lightning and campers nro almos' equally responsible for CO per cent of all tho forest fires In district No. 4 of tho forest service according to 1 records kept for tho four years, 1910-1013, 1910-1013, whllo fires of an Incendiary o--lg'n amount to only 2 per cent of tho total loss of J83G.134 from fires In tho four years, the fire of 1910 consumed $S19,G28.G2 worth or 9S per cent of tho 'total and of this 98 per cent a total loss of $767,500 or 92 per cent occurred on six forests across tho north part of tho district tho Teton. Palisade, Salmon, ClmlMs, Idaho and Welser. This belt is ihero fore considered the dangerous fue zone of district 4. In thp four yeara a total of 151 000 acres of t'mherod land and '2,000 ncres of open pnsturo land were bun ed over. Tho expense of fire isht-Ing isht-Ing was $56,000 In 1910, $3000 in 1311 and less than $1,000 each In 1912 aid 1913. |
